The maximum price thar can be legally charged for a good or service is called what

Respuesta :

MrsTriplet MrsTriplet
  • 05-03-2018
The maximum price that can be legally charged for a good or service is called the price ceiling. The government sets this limit to protect consumers from businesses setting items that are needed to live everyday life unattainable due to the price.
